Shutter painting services involve applying a fresh coat of paint or stain to the exterior shutters of a home or building. This process typically includes cleaning the shutters thoroughly to remove dirt, mold, or peeling paint, followed by sanding or priming as needed to ensure a smooth surface. Once prepared, skilled contractors carefully apply paint or stain to enhance the appearance and protect the shutters from weather damage. This service can help restore the charm of a property, making it look well-maintained and attractive.

Many property owners turn to shutter painting to address issues caused by exposure to the elements, such as fading, chipping, or peeling paint that diminishes curb appeal. Over time, shutters can become discolored or damaged, which may give the impression of neglect. Painting or staining can also help prevent wood rot or decay by creating a protective barrier against moisture and sunlight. This service is a practical solution for those looking to extend the life of their shutters while improving the overall look of their home.

The overview below groups typical Shutter Painting proj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Washington County, MN.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or shutter painting projects, such as touch-ups or repainting a few shutters,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the number of shutters and their condition.

Standard Repainting - For repainting entire sets of shutters on a home, local contractors usually charge between $600-$1,200. Larger, more detailed projects can push costs higher, but most projects stay within this typical range.

Full Shutter Restoration - Complete restoration and repainting of older or heavily damaged shutters can range from $1,200-$3,000 or more. These projects are less common and tend to fall into the higher end of the cost spectrum.

Full Replacement - When shutters need to be replaced entirely, costs vary widely based on material and size, often starting around $1,500 and exceeding $5,000 for custom or high-end options. Most projects in this category are larger and more complex, leading to higher costs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is shutter painting? Shutter painting involves applying a fresh coat of paint or decorative finish to exterior or interior window shutters to enhance their appearance and protect the material.

Why should I consider professional shutter painting services? Professional contractors can ensure an even, high-quality finish, proper surface preparation, and use of suitable paints for durability and aesthetic appeal.

What types of shutters can be painted? Most common shutter types, including wood, vinyl, and composite, can be painted or refinished by experienced service providers in the area.

How do local contractors prepare shutters for painting? Preparation typically involves cleaning, sanding, and priming surfaces to ensure paint adhesion and a smooth, lasting finish.

Can shutter painting be combined with other exterior updates? Yes, many local service providers can coordinate shutter painting with other exterior improvements like siding or trim updates for a cohesive look.
